Autonomic
Pertaining to the autonomic nervous system that controls involuntary bodily functions such as heartbeat and digestion.
Nervous System
The network of nerve cells and fibers that transmits signals between different parts of the body, coordinating actions and sensory information.
Brain-Damaged Patients
Individuals who have experienced injury to the brain, which can result in a wide range of impairments in cognitive function, motor skills, and emotional behavior.
Emotional Intelligence
A capacity for recognizing our own feelings and those of others, for motivating ourselves, and for managing emotions well in ourselves and in our relationships.
